Product overview

The VT7200 PI thermostat family is specifically designed for zoning applications.
Typical applications include local hydronic reheat valve control and pressure
dependent VAV with or without local reheat. The product features a backlit LCD
display with dedicated function menu keys for simple operation. Accurate
temperature control is achieved due to the product’s PI proportional control
algorithm, which virtually eliminates temperature offset associated with traditional,
differential-based thermostats. Models are available for 3 point floating and analog
0 to 10 Vdc control. In addition remote room sensing is available. They all contain
an SPST auxiliary switch that can be used to control lighting or auxiliary reheat. All
devices are also available with Echelon or BACnet MS-TP network adapter.

Features and benefits

Features

Benefits

• Advanced occupancy functions

⇒ Through the network or smart local occupancy

sensing

• 3 configurable inputs

⇒ Adds functionality

• Pre-configured sequences of operation

⇒ One model meet more applications

⇒ Reduces project delivery cost

• Unique configuration setup utility

⇒ Minimizes parameter tampering

• Lockable keypad

⇒ Tamper proof, no need for thermostat guards

• Available for 24 Vac On/Off, Floating or Analog

control

⇒ Meet advanced applications requirements

• Auxiliary output

⇒ Can be used for lighting or reheat

• Available with various open industry standards

communication adapters

⇒ Adds network integration functionality for

additional savings
